Genetic Diversity of Chinese Kale Based on SSR Markers

Abstract: Classification and genetic diversity of local varieties in Chinese kale were studied before.With the extending of Chinese kale hybrids,they can show higher heterosis and better benefit.Therefore study on genetic diversity of inbred lines is important now.In this research,98 Chinese kale inbred lines were analyzed by 15 polymorphic SSR markers which were selected from 55 pairs of primers locating on 9 chromosomes of cabbage.65 polymorphic bands were detected by these 15 pairs of primers.UPGMA method was used to determine genetic diversities of 98 Chinese kale inbred lines.They were initially clustered intoⅠ,Ⅱ,Ⅲ,Ⅳ,Ⅴ groups with coefficient 0.71.Results can be used to breed Chinese kale including selection and match of parents,identification of hybrids and protection of resources.
